Show affiliationsAn expansion for the free energy functional of the Sherrington–Kirkpatrick (SK) model, around the replica symmetric (RS) SK solution Q(RS)ab = δab + q(1 − δab) is investigated. In particular, when the expansion is truncated to the fourth order in Qab − Q(RS)ab the full replica symmetry broken (FRSB) solution is explicitly found but it turns out to exist only in the range of temperature 0.549... ≤ T ≤ Tc = 1, not including T = 0. On the other hand, an expansion around the paramagnetic solution Q(PM)ab = δab, up to the fourth order, yields a FRSB solution that exists in a limited temperature range 0.915... ≤ T ≤ Tc = 1.
